#EAAF36 Hex color

#EAAF36

The hexadecimal color code #EAAF36 corresponds to the code RGB( 234, 175, 54 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,92 level), green (at 0,69 level) and blue (at 0,21 level). Its brightness is 56% and its saturation is 81%. It is composed of red at 50%, green at 37% and blue at 11%.
